Transaction 628c9d3d56f61fe89d522c9cd06b55b001fb178dae36a46876eae789e8a8c5cb

2 Input
2 Outputs
  • 628c9d3d56f61fe89d522c9cd06b55b001fb178dae36a46876eae789e8a8c5cb:0
  • value  23650000
    address  165DBHkwus2CgfXNjXYvA4Tr4qGvfxiDLg
  • 628c9d3d56f61fe89d522c9cd06b55b001fb178dae36a46876eae789e8a8c5cb:1
  • value  33835714
    address  1H19Hq1PRmjH9t7jWAqNQgmAKefwtuvVV3